I got an SSD driver as system disk (120GB). Sandboxie is installed on that driver. However If I choose d,e,f drive for installation locations within sandboxie, that will (obviously) create a "link" on sandboxie's c: installation for those drivers.
Question:
How can I make sandboxie to use d,e,f,etc. drivers when I choose those drivers for app installation?
This is a matter of saving space and utilizing other drivers. my D drive is a junk/temp drive, my f drive is my main program files. I don't really use c for installing non-system specific apps/drivers.

Re: How to change use d,e,f, etc. drive locations?
To elaborate:
Use Sandboxie Control > Sandbox > Set Container Folder
if you want all sandboxes to be created on a drive other than C:
Use the FileRootPath setting to put individual sandboxes on different drives:
http://forums.sandboxie.com/phpBB3/view ... 1094#51094
Or, use a combination of both of those:
Set Container Folder for drive D: for example, and all sandboxes will be created there. But you can still manually add the FileRootPath setting for a sandbox, and put it on a different drive.

I've having hard time to understand the logic here. How will Sandboxie know that If I choose d:\Program Files (x86) for a new application to be installed to use the sandboxie folder on the D:\Sandbox\%Sandbox%? Or It's working and I shouldn't worry about it?
Re: How to change use d,e,f, etc. drive locations?
It will depend on which sandbox you start the application in and which path you have chosen for that sandbox.
eg if you set
[DefaultBox]
FileRootPath=D:\Sandbox\%USER%\%SANDBOX%
and start the app in the defaultbox then that's the path it will use. (D:\)
If you set up a new box let's call it box2
[Box2]
FileRootPath=E:\Sandbox\%USER%\%SANDBOX%
and start the app in this one instead it will use (E:\)
